The campaign committee of Republican Party candidate Michael Vilardi, Vilardi for Congress, received $500 from David Garvin on February 4, according to the Federal Election Commission (FEC).

Vilardi for Congress has received $1,500 in contributions since the beginning of the year.

The following table lists all contributions reported by the committee this year.
